Regular Season Round 33: Blois - Nancy 80-88
Date: May 7, 2022
An exciting game between Top Four teams was played in Blois. First ranked Sluc Nancy faced 4th placed ADA Blois. Guests from Nancy (26-9) defeated host ADA Blois (20-14) 88-80. They outrebounded ADA Blois 33-21 including 25 on the defensive glass. It was a great shooting night for Sluc Nancy especially from behind the arc, where they had solid 56.3 percentage. Their players were unselfish on offense dishing 24 assists. It was a good game for Stephane Gombauld (205-1997) who led his team to a victory with a double-double by scoring 25 points and 11 rebounds. American guard Caleb Walker (194-1989, college: Nebraska) contributed with 16 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ists for the winners. Senegalese Mbaye Ndiaye (203-1999) answered with 20 points and 6 rebounds and American forward Tyren Johnson (201-1988, college: La-Lafayette) added 14 points and 4 assists in the effort for ADA Blois. Both coaches tested many bench players and allowed the starting five to rest. The victory was the twelfth consecutive win for Sluc Nancy. They maintain first place with 26-9 record. ADA Blois at the other side dropped to the fifth position with 14 games lost. Sluc Nancy will play against Chalon/Saor (#7) at home in the next round which should be theoretically an easy game. ADA Blois will play against Tours and hopes to get back on the winning track.
